Instructions. Cut two 4"x4" squares from your first (main) fabric and one 4"x4" square in the fabric for your second (triangle.) Cut one 4"x4" square of interfacing. To make the corner piece, fold the 4"x4" square in your second (triangle) fabric with wrong sides together into a triangle. Press with a warm iron.

Press. Iron the square piece of interfacing onto the back of one of the other squares of fabric. Step 2: Assemble and sew the bookmark Now place the square of fabric that you attached the interfacing to on the table, face up. Place the triangle of fabric on top in the correct place to form the bookmark.

Using a 1/4 inch seam sew all the way around the edge leaving about a 2-inch opening for turning fabric inside out. Make sure to catch all layers. Trim close to stitching and clip corners. Turn right side out and press. Using about a 1/8 inch seam stitch all the way around the edge.

How to make corner bookmarks 1. Start with a square sheet of paper. If your paper is rectangular, fold one corner diagonally to the opposite edge and trim off the excess paper to form a square. 2. Fold the paper diagonally in half to form a triangle. Make sure the edges align neatly, and make a firm crease along the folded edge. 3.

Step 1: Start with a 6" square of paper. Flip it over so the back side faces up, and rotate it 45 degrees like a diamond. Fold the paper in half by taking the bottom point and bringing it up to meet the top point. Step 2: Take the right point and bring it up to meet the top point, and fold.
